Blackstone Cowboy Stir Fry Dinner

A quick and flavorful beef and veggie stir-fry cooked in a single pan, perfect for a weeknight meal.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: American, Asian
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 1 lb tender beef (such as flank steak, sliced) Slice thin against the grain for tenderness.
  • 2 cups mixed vegetables (such as bell peppers, broccoli, and snap peas) Use a variety of vegetables for color and texture.
Sauce and Seasoning
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ce Can substitute with gluten-free soy sauce.
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il For cooking.
  • 1 tablespoon garlic (minced) Freshly minced for best flavor.
  • 1 tablespoon ginger (grated) Fresh ginger preferred.
  • to taste Salt and pepper Used to season the beef.
For Serving
  • as needed Cooked rice or noodles For serving.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et or on a Blackstone griddle over medium-high heat.
  2. Add the sliced beef and season with salt and pepper. Cook until browned, about 3-5 minutes.
  3. Add the garlic and ginger, stirring for about 1 minute until fragrant.
Cooking
  1. Add the mixed vegetables to the pan and stir-fry until tender, about 3-4 minutes.
  2. Pour in the soy sauce, tossing everything together to coat. Cook for an additional minute.
Serving
  1. Serve hot over cooked rice or noodles, and sprinkle with extra pepper or green onion if desired.

Notes

Let the dish cool to room temperature before storing.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
